Choosing between D.Pharm (Diploma in Pharmacy) and B.Pharm (Bachelor of Pharmacy) is a crucial decision for students interested in a career in the pharmaceutical industry. Both courses are beneficial in their own way and serve various purposes. In this exhaustive guide spanning curriculum, duration, career, salary, employment, and others to make the right course selection for yourself, here is an intensive comparison.
1. Overview of D.Pharm and B.Pharm
D.Pharm (Diploma in Pharmacy):
- Two-year diploma course as per the Pharmacy Council of India (PCI).
- For students who want quick career entry into the pharma sector.
- Emphasizes basic knowledge in pharmacy practice.
- B.Pharm (Bachelor of Pharmacy):
- Four-year bachelor course.
- Develops good theoretical and practical education of pharmacy.
Suitable for students who are looking for greater career prospects in research, production, and regulatory affairs.
2. Eligibility Criteria
D.Pharm
10+2 with Physics, Chemistry, and Biology/Mathematics.
Minimum 50% marks in most of the institutions.
B.Pharm:
10+2 with Physics, Chemistry, and Biology/Mathematics.
Entrance tests may be conducted by some institutions.
3. Course Duration and Structure
D.Pharm:
- 2 years duration.
- Comprehensive practical training in hospitals or pharmaceutical shops.
- Subjects: Pharmaceutics, Pharmaceutical Chemistry, Pharmacology, Hospital & Clinical Pharmacy.
B.Pharm:
- Duration: 4 years (8 semesters).
- Comprises industrial training and project work.
- Subjects: Human Anatomy, Biochemistry, Pharmacognosy, Pharmaceutical Jurisprudence, Clinical Pharmacy.
4. Career Opportunities

After D.Pharm:
- Retail or hospital pharmacy pharmacist.
- Medical representative.
- Start own medical shop.
- Eligible to study B.Pharm through lateral entry.
After B.Pharm:
- Clinical Research Associate.
- Drug Inspector.
- Regulatory Affairs Officer.
- Pharmaceutical Marketing.
- Production and Quality Control Executive.
- Can opt for higher studies like M.Pharm or MBA.
5. Salary and Career Growth
D.Pharm:
- Initial Salary: INR 15,000 – 25,000 per month.
- Based on experience and skills.
B.Pharm:
- Initial Salary: INR 25,000 – 45,000 per month.
- Opportunity for rapid growth and superior posts.
6. Government and Private Job Opportunities
D.Pharm:
- Government pharmacist positions in hospitals, health centers.
- Railways, defence industry.
B.Pharm:
- PSUs.
- Drug inspector tests, food safety inspectors.
- Research careers in government-sponsored projects.
7. Higher Education Opportunities
D.Pharm Holders:
- May pursue B.Pharm through lateral entry (admission to 2nd year).
- Few direct postgraduate opportunities.
B.Pharm Graduates:
- M.Pharm (Master of Pharmacy).
- Pharm.D (Doctor of Pharmacy).
- MBA in Pharmaceutical Management.
8. International Scope
D.Pharm:
- Few opportunities abroad.
- Might have to do B.Pharm or equivalent to work abroad.
B.Pharm:
- Accepted in majority of nations after license exams (e.g., NAPLEX, PEBC).
- Increased international demand in research and clinical trials.
9. Course Fees Comparison
D.Pharm:
Usually inexpensive.
Fee Range: INR 30,000 – 1,00,000 annually.
B.Pharm:
Greater fee due to higher duration and infrastructure.
Fee Range: INR 50,000 – 2,00,000 annually.
10. Which One Should You Pick?
Choose D.Pharm if:
- You want to enter work early.
- You are looking for a cost-effective beginning for your pharma career.
- You want to own a pharmacy.
Choose B.Pharm if:
- You want senior jobs in pharma industries.
- You want a platform for postgraduate studies.
- You want to go into research, clinical trials, or drug regulation.
Conclusion
D.Pharm and B.Pharm are both worth pursuing as pharmacy career streams, but the best choice is really up to you based on your personal goals, budget, and time commitment. If you desire immediate employment and general practice of pharmacy, D.Pharm is the way to go. But if you’re aiming for a long-term, growth-based career with potential for specialization and global exposure, B.Pharm is the better path. Consider your goals thoroughly before making a decision, as your pharmacy education will determine your future in this expanding and influential field.

Shreya Singh is a dedicated professor and lecturer with a strong academic background in pharmaceuticals and education. She completed her D. Pharma from Chandigarh University and holds a B.Ed. from Delhi University. With years of teaching experience at the college level, Shreya brings deep subject knowledge and a passion for learning to every classroom and blog post. An avid writer and educator, she enjoys sharing insightful content, simplifying complex topics, and helping students and readers grow academically and professionally.